Birds Of Paradise
Neuma, 2025
9/10
An electronic score by the highly creative Juraj Kojš and the dancers of Pioneer Winter Collective, the 8 tracks of experimental and atypical sounds touch on spoken word, dance music and social justice.
The beat driven “Barbara” opens with strategic humming and rich percussive ideas, and “Josue” follows with warm piano and powerful wordplay from the spoken word amid a spacey backdrop.
“Gabriela” and “Katrina” occupy the middle tracks. The former is rich and dreamy with very precise instrumentation that’s aligned with wordless singing, while the latter enters sci-fi territory via the mysterious ambience and jarring bouts.
Residing near the end, “Shamar” seems like the soundtrack to another dimension with its highly unusual electronic exploration, and “Lotte” exits with a breathy demeanor and radiant instrumentation that builds into an emotive and buzzing finish.
A very inventive affair that embraces singing, humming, speaking, breathing, stomping, and heart-beating, Kojš’ electronic prowess is nothing short of gripping, either.
